
No, that’s not the Ghost of Christmas Future in the picture today. That hooded AI villain is supposed to represent a cyber-attack!
MrFireStation seems to have been attacked last week over Thanksgiving. Helpful reader and Doberman-like guard dog, Klaus Wentzel, noticed last week that his comments have been blocked. I found them in a “pending” bucket.
He wondered if website traffic had ground to a halt, but the opposite was true. Over 14K hits came in from China!

It’s not uncommon for me to see “hits” from China, but almost 95% of the visitors I get are from English-speaking countries. I’ve never seen thousands of visitors from China like this before.
The traffic was to almost all pages on the site. For some reason, the relatively off-topic Vintage Christmas Album Covers (!) was the most popular with almost 700 hits alone. Most posts had 25-40 visitors, but some had zero.
I couldn’t find anything nefarious going on with the site, but it seemed like it must be an attack of some kind. At Klaus’ urging, I changed all of the WordPress passwords and made them longer. Some of them hadn’t been updated in a few years.
